Well here's the thing. If a person who is part of your clinical trial has a heart attack or dies while taking the medicine, you have to warn people that the med may cause heart attacks. It doesn't matter if the person had a history of heart disease and lives off lard and cooking fat, the heart attack occurred while on the meds so you must report it as a possible side affect. So when you see a constipation suppository with a SIDE EFFECT: MAY DIE OF BRAIN CANCER, there's a good chance someone during the trial died of pre-existing brain cancer.
